PRINCE2 (PRojects IN Controlled Environments) is a project management methodology that provides a framework for managing projects of any size and complexity. PRINCE2 training offers benefits for both individuals and organizations, and in this blog post, we will explore those benefits in more detail.

PRINCE2 was first developed by the UK government in the 1980s, and it has since become one of the most popular project management methodologies in the world. It is widely used in both the public and private sectors, and it is recognized as a best practice approach to project management.

PRINCE2 is designed to be flexible and adaptable, and it can be used for projects of any size and complexity. It is based on a process-based approach, which means that each project is broken down into a series of manageable steps, and each step is governed by a set of processes and procedures. This helps to ensure that projects are completed on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.

Benefits of PRINCE2 training for individuals:

  1. Improved project management skills: PRINCE2 training provides individuals with a comprehensive understanding of the principles, processes, themes, and techniques of project management. This training enables individuals to effectively manage projects, from initiation to closure, ensuring that proj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.
  2. Professional development: PRINCE2 certification is recognized globally, and it is a valuable addition to an individual’s resume. PRINCE2 training and certification demonstrate an individual’s commitment to professional development and their expertise in project management.
  3. Increased job opportunities: Many organizations require project managers to be certified in PRINCE2. Therefore, individuals who have completed PRINCE2 training and certification have a competitive advantage when applying for project management roles.
  4. Greater job satisfaction: Effective project management can be incredibly rewarding. PRINCE2 training provides individuals with the tools and techniques they need to manage projects successfully, which can lead to greater job satisfaction.

Benefits of PRINCE2 training for organizations:

  1. Consistent approach to project management: PRINCE2 provides a structured approach to project management, ensuring that all projects are managed in a consistent and controlled manner. This approach leads to improved project outcomes, increased efficiency, and reduced risk.
  2. Improved project success rates: Effective project management is essential for the success of any organization. PRINCE2 training provides project managers with the skills and knowledge they need to manage projects successfully, increasing the likelihood of project success.
  3. Increased productivity: PRINCE2 training provides project managers with the tools and techniques they need to manage projects efficiently. This approach leads to increased productivity, enabling organizations to deliver more projects with the same resources.
  4. Reduced risk: PRINCE2 training provides project managers with a comprehensive understanding of risk management. This knowledge enables project managers to identify potential risks and develop strategies to mitigate them, reducing the risk of project failure.
